What are CS2 Gambling Sites?
CS2 gambling sites are third-party online platforms-- independent of Valve, the game's designer-- that allow users to bet virtual skins (knives, rifles, gloves) or digital currencies (Bitcoin, Ethereum, fiat) on casino-style games.
Unlike official in-game mechanics like opening weapon cases, third-party sites offer a much wider variety of gameplay styles, typically including social components, chatrooms, and player-versus-player (PvP) modes.
Typical Game Modes Found on CS2 Platforms
A lot of platforms offer a similar suite of video games designed around fast rounds and high enjoyment. Here are the most prevalent types:
- Case Battles: Multiple players buy into the exact same virtual cases. Whoever opens products with the greatest total value at the end of the round wins all the dropped skins.
- Crash: A multiplier starts at 1.00 x and climbs rapidly. Gamers should squander before the multiplier randomly "crashes." If they stop working to cash out in time, they lose their wager.
- Live roulette: Similar to traditional casino roulette, but typically adjusted with 3 colors (e.g., terrorist, counter-terrorist, and neutral/bonus).
- Coinflip: A classic 1v1 game where 2 gamers wager skins of roughly equal value, and a virtual coin flip identifies the winner.
- Jackpot: Players pool their skins into a central pot. Each skin adds to the player's "tickets." A random draw selects a winner, with higher-value contributions yielding a better statistical opportunity of winning.
How CS2 Gambling Works: The Mechanics
Comprehending the underlying mechanics assists debunk how these websites function. Historically, skin CS Gambling Sites counted on Steam API integration, enabling bots to help with trade deals. While the method of deposit and withdrawal has developed-- especially following Valve's different limitations on automated trading bots-- the core loop remains constant.
The Transaction Lifecycle
- Deposit: Players log in via their Steam accounts. They deposit CS2 skins from their Steam stock or money their accounts utilizing cryptocurrencies or credit cards.
- Conversion: Skins are usually converted into an on-site balance (credits or coins) based upon their real-market value.
- Betting: Players utilize their balance to play various games on the platform.
- Withdrawal: Successful gamers transform their on-site balance back into skins by requesting a trade offer from a platform bot, or by cashing out via crypto.

While these platforms provide entertainment, they carry substantial risks that individuals should think about.
Key Risks to Keep in Mind
- Absence of Regulation: Unlike conventional online gambling establishments accredited by recognized government bodies (e.g., the UK CSGO Gambling Commission or Malta Gaming Authority), many CS2 sites operate in regulatory grey locations. This means customer protection laws may not apply.
- Your House Edge: Virtually all games are mathematically weighted in favor of the platform. Gradually, your home constantly wins.
- Account Security and Scams: Logging into unverified third-party websites can expose users to phishing frauds, API key theft, and the permanent loss of important Steam inventories.
- Valve's Crackdowns: Valve often updates its regards to service and takes action against accounts and bot networks related to industrial gambling. Modifications to Steam's trading policies can immediately limit a user's capability to withdraw or move skins.
- Financial and Psychological Risks: The busy nature of skin CSGO Gambling Sites can lead to compulsive behaviors and substantial financial losses.
Safety and Security Best Practices
For those who pick to check out CS2 gambling sites, adhering to stringent digital health and security procedures is necessary to secure individual properties and accounts.
- Never Share Login Credentials: Only log into third-party sites utilizing the main OpenID Steam login prompt. Never ever type your Steam password straight into a custom field on an unverified website.
- Secure Your API Key: Malicious sites can take your Steam API key to obstruct trade offers. Regularly examine your Steam account settings to ensure no unapproved API keys are active.
- Set Strict Budgets: Treat gambling purely as a form of paid home entertainment rather than a way to generate income. Never bet skins or funds you can not pay for to lose.
- Research Platforms: Look for platforms with recognized reputations, transparent "Provably Fair" systems (which permit users to confirm the randomness of game results), and responsive consumer support.
- Usage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Ensure your Steam Guard Mobile Authenticator is active at all times.
